The Federal Register, published by the Office of the Federal Register, National Archives and Records Administration, is the official, daily publication for rules, proposed rules, and notices of Federal agencies and organizations, as well as executive orders and other presidential documents.

Notices regarding non-rulemaking policy statements and non-rulemaking guidance posted under the FFIEC are available at either http://www.regulations.gov or http://www.archives.gov/federal-register/index.html.


PUBLIC COMMENTS (follow either of the two methods below):

1. Electronic submission:

  • Go to http://www.regulations.gov enter "FFIEC" into the search text box provided. If you do not see the posting you are looking for on the page that comes up, narrow your search by going to the left-hand column and under "Narrow Results" select "more" under the heading "Agency" and choose "FFIEC" from the full list that appears.
  • The most current postings will be listed first, and the comment due date will be shown in the detail under the document heading.
  • You will have the option to attach an electronic file containing your comment or type your comment directly into the comment field provided on the site.
  • Select the “Comment Now!” box to submit your electronic comments, (it appears in a blue box to the right of the document title and the comment closing date appears directly under the “Comment Now!” box). If the comment period has expired that area will read “Comment Period Closed.”
